Melasma is one of the most challenging forms of pigmentation to treat. It can be persistent, unpredictable and often requires a long-term approach rather than a quick fix.

Great results with melasma are rarely about one treatment alone. It’s about understanding the skin, identifying the triggers, choosing the right treatments at the right time, and being consistent throughout the journey.

With Chloe, we’ve taken a carefully tailored approach to target pigmentation, improve uneven tone and gradually restore a brighter, clearer and healthier-looking complexion.

Melasma can take time, patience and consistency - but these results show just how much can be achieved with the right approach🤍

Got a tattoo you no longer want? You don’t have to live with it forever🤌🏼

With PicoSure Pro, ultra-short laser pulses target and shatter tattoo ink into tiny particles, allowing your body to naturally clear them away over time. Treatment is quick, with minimal downtime, and suitable for many ink colours.

Every tattoo is unique, so the number of treatments needed varies. Factors like the tattoo’s size, age, colours, depth and your skin all play a role. While most tattoos require multiple sessions for the best results, we’ll create a personalised treatment plan during your consultation.

🚨 Stop believing this grey hair myth…

You’ve probably heard that if you pluck one grey hair, two or three more will grow back… but that’s not true!

Each hair grows from its own individual follicle, so removing one grey hair won’t cause the surrounding hairs to turn grey or multiply.

Grey hairs appear because your hair follicles gradually produce less melanin as you age - it’s completely natural and mostly down to genetics.

That said, constantly plucking grey hairs isn’t the best idea. Repeated plucking can irritate or damage the follicle, which may lead to thinner hair or stop that hair from growing back altogether.

So next time someone tells you plucking grey hairs makes more appear… you can confidently tell them it’s a myth!

The eyes never lie. They’re often the very first feature to reveal the effects of ageing - but true rejuvenation is about far more than simply filling hollows.

Restoring lost volume is only one part of the equation. Regenerating the quality of the skin and supporting the body’s own healing processes is what creates natural, long-lasting results.

I’ve been performing facial fat transfer for well over a decade, continually refining my technique as both the science and technology have evolved. Every step of the process matters - from harvesting and processing to purification and precise placement.

For my wife Henal Somji , I performed advanced periorbital fat transfer using a combination of nanofat, stromal vascular fraction (SVF) and platelet-rich fibrin (PRF) to harness the body’s own regenerative potential.

Using the Puregraft system allows us to thoroughly purify the harvested fat by removing unwanted blood, oil and inflammatory debris, while the NanoCube system creates a highly consistent nanofat with controlled particulate size for smoother delivery into the delicate tissues around the eyes.

The goal isn’t simply to fill hollows - it is to support tissue regeneration, improve skin quality, enhance vascularity and create a more natural, refreshed appearance over time. This is something fillers cannot do.

Regenerative medicine has transformed what we can achieve with fat transfer. By combining meticulous surgical technique with the latest processing technologies, we’re moving beyond simply replacing lost volume and towards encouraging the body’s own healing and regenerative processes.

Every patient requires an individual assessment, and not everyone is suitable for this approach, but in the right patient it can be one of the most rewarding procedures in facial rejuvenation.
